    Abstract: A Multi-Function Peripheral (MFP) is provided with a locked mailbox bin. The MFP receives a print job, calculates a print quantity for a case in which the received print job is executed. If the calculated print quantity for the print job is more than a predetermined quantity, the MFP executes printing based on the print job with the locked mailbox bin designated as an output destination of a printed material. If the calculated print quantity for the print job is equal to or less than the predetermined quantity, the MFP stores the print job in a storage portion.

    Abstract: A magnetic heat pump cycle has a first to a fourth steps, which are repeatedly carried out. In the first step, a movement of heat medium is stopped by a pressure valve and a pressure accumulating tank and a magnetic field is applied by a magnetic-field control unit to a magnetic working material. In the second step, the pressure valve is opened so that the heat medium flows in a working chamber from a second axial end to a first axial end, and the magnetic field is increased depending on a moving speed of the heat medium. In the third step, the movement of the heat medium is stopped and the magnetic field is decreased. In the fourth step, the heat medium is moved in a reversed direction and the magnetic field is decreased depending on the moving speed of the heat medium.
